National Junior Chess championship begins Tuesday

Greenwatch News Desk Other Sports 2022-02-13, 8:34pm




Dhaka, 13 Feb  - The 40th National Junior (Under-20) Chess Championships Open and Girls begins Tuesday (Feb 15) at the chess federation hall-room of the National Sports Council old building in the city, said a press release.

Only those who were born after January 1, 2002, will be allowed to participate in this event, organized by the Bangladesh Chess Federation.

The intending players in participating are asked to enroll their names from their respective educational institutions along with age certificate and prescribed entry fee.

The competition will be played in nine round Swiss-league system.
